Job Description :
Role : Marklogic Consultant


Location : Raritan NJ


Duration : Long Term


 


• Bachelor39;s degree in Computer Science, Software Engineering, Information Technology, or related field required


• At least 5+ years of hands-on application development utilizing the Marklogic framework.


• Develop and maintain content ingestion, validation and transformation, populating the MarkLogicXML repository Develop XQuery modules and Rest APIs to support complex searches against the database


• Develop POCs that demonstrate cutting-edge solutions employing established data science and search methods (Machine Learning, Semantic Enrichment, NLP, RDFs) contribute to the definition and implementation the enterprises Master Data Management architecture


• Develop XQuery, Javascript and REST modules on the Marklogic technology stack Utilize the Marklogic library to support GRC initiatives


• Design and development of solutions that integrate Marklogic with existing enterprise platforms and systems.


• Experience with implementing the Marklogic java-client-api within an enterprise application.


• Strong analytical and design skills, including the ability to understand business requirements and translate them into efficient and effective technical designs that work well within large-scale, well-structured enterprise environments


• Direct experience with commonly accepted industry architectures/technologies including J2EE, .NET, XML, XSLT, SOA/Web Services, SQL, HTML, HTTP, Javascript, REST •


Experience with XML and related technologies (XSLT and/or XQuery)


• Strong knowledge of XQuery, JavaScript, SPARQL, FLWOR, RDF Data, triples and XML are essential


• Understanding of database architecture and performance implications


• Experience working with some combination of search engines, relational databases, ETL tools, geospatial systems, semantic technology, knowledge-management systems, NoSQL databases and content-management systems


• Excellent trouble-shooting skills, with the ability to quickly identify and document the root cause of issues, and effectively communicate possible resolutions


• Experience leveraging NoSQL databases and verifying data quality.


• Experience with mlcp and transforms for loading data.


• Experience with Unix/Shell scripting.
             

Similar Jobs you may be interested in ..